Tour of the Pointe du Chardonnet
A combination of the Tignes Resort and the heart of the national park. The contrast is amazing but telling of the history of the Vanoise.
Moderate Hiking
- Distance
- 13 km
- Ascent
- 793 m
- Descent
- 793 m
